1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the formula for the surface area of a rectangular prism?

Back

Surface Area = 2(lw + lh + wh), where l = length, w = width, h = height.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the formula for the volume of a rectangular prism?

Back

Volume = l × w × h, where l = length, w = width, h = height.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What units are used to measure surface area?

Back

Square units (e.g., cm², in², m²).

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What units are used to measure volume?

Back

Cubic units (e.g., cm³, in³, m³).

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

If a rectangular prism has a length of 5 in, width of 4 in, and height of 3 in, what is its volume?

Back

Volume = 5 in × 4 in × 3 in = 60 in³.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you find the surface area of a prism with a square base?

Back

Surface Area = 2B + Ph, where B = area of the base, P = perimeter of the base, h = height.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the perimeter of a rectangle with length 6 cm and width 4 cm?

Back

Perimeter = 2(l + w) = 2(6 cm + 4 cm) = 20 cm.
